When I went on a two week cruise last year, I was faced with the challenge of packing for a variety of activities and weather conditions. I started by researching the destinations and the average weather during the time of my cruise. This helped me determine the types of clothing I would need to pack, such as lightweight clothes for warmer days and a few layers for cooler evenings.
I also made sure to pack versatile pieces that could be mixed and matched to create different outfits. This helped me save space in my suitcase while still having plenty of options to choose from. I packed a few pairs of shorts, skirts, and pants, along with several tops and dresses that could be dressed up or down.
In addition to clothing, I made sure to pack all the necessary toiletries and medications. I also packed a small first aid kit, just in case. To save space, I transferred my toiletries into travel-sized containers and only brought the essentials.
When it came to shoes, I packed a comfortable pair of walking shoes, sandals, and a pair of dressier shoes for formal nights on the cruise. I also packed a foldable rain jacket and a lightweight sweater for cooler evenings.

The hidden secret of how to pack for a two week cruise lies in the art of packing cubes. These small, lightweight bags are a game-changer when it comes to organizing your suitcase and maximizing space.
Packing cubes allow you to separate your clothes and belongings into different compartments, making it easier to find what you need and keeping everything neat and organized. They also compress your items, allowing you to fit more into your suitcase.
Another hidden secret is to roll your clothes instead of folding them. This not only saves space but also helps prevent wrinkles. Rolling your clothes tightly and placing them in packing cubes or vacuum-sealed bags can make a significant difference in how much you can fit in your suitcase.

When it comes to packing for a two week cruise, here are some additional tips and tricks to help make the process easier:
- Roll your clothes instead of folding them to save space and prevent wrinkles.
- Use travel-sized containers for toiletries to minimize the amount of space they take up.
- Pack a small first aid kit with essentials such as band-aids, pain relievers, and motion sickness medication.
- Bring a reusable water bottle to stay hydrated during your cruise.
- Consider packing a few laundry pods or detergent sheets to do laundry onboard the ship if needed.

Q: Should I bring a different outfit for every day of the cruise?
A: No, packing a different outfit for every day of the cruise is not necessary. Instead, focus on packing versatile clothing pieces that can be mixed and matched to create different outfits.
Q: How can I save space in my suitcase?
A: To save space in your suitcase, try rolling your clothes instead of folding them. You can also use packing cubes to compress your items and keep them organized.
Q: What should I pack for formal nights on the cruise?
A: For formal nights, it's best to pack a dressier outfit such as a cocktail dress or a suit. Check with your cruise line for specific dress code requirements.
Q: How many pairs of shoes should I bring?
A: It's best to bring a comfortable pair of walking shoes, sandals, and a dressier pair of shoes for formal nights. Limiting your shoe selection can help save space in your suitcase.
